Objectives
Students should be able to:
- recognise and appropriately apply specific vocabulary related to management information systems;
- apply a set of linguistic and sociocultural skills in specific communicative situations;
- use textual interpretation and production skills correctly in accordance with structural and grammatical rules;
- communicate fluently and reproduce real-life situations.

Program
A. Thematic content:
1. English as a global language - Everyday communication; oral interaction in specific contexts.
2. The world of work - Specific documents: CVs; formal/professional correspondence and emails; career opportunities; interviews.
3. Current developments in management information systems - Text analysis.
4. New technologies
B. Grammar content: verb tenses; articles; adjectives; passive voice; affixation rules; conditional clauses.

Evaluation Methodology
* Frequency assessment (covers all students except those covered by other legal statutes).
• A written test - minimum grade of 8 - (50%)
• A written assignment with oral presentation - (30%);
• Continuous assessment: participation in classes in the written and oral components/practical work carried out in the classroom (20%).

All assessment components are compulsory. If any of them are missing, the student is automatically admitted to the exam.

* Working students:
• A written test - minimum grade of 8 - (70%)
• A written assignment with oral presentation - (30%)
* Assessment by Exam
• A written test - minimum grade of 8 - (70%)
• A written assignment with oral presentation - (30%)
Students are approved if they obtain a grade higher than 10, according to the weightings assigned to all assessment items.
